Japan Energy Begins Shipping Diesel Oil to China Under 1-Yr Accord

July 11, 2005

Jul. 11–TOKYO — Japan Energy Corp. said Monday it has begun shipping diesel oil to China United Petroleum Corp. under a one-year contract effective through next March.

Japan Energy is the first Japanese oil distributor to export diesel oil to a major Chinese oil company under a long-term contract, the Tokyo-based company said.

The contract calls for Japan Energy to supply 140,000 kiloliters of diesel oil, equal to about half of the shipments from Japan to China in fiscal 2004.

Japan Energy concluded the deal, valued at an estimated 6.5 billion yen, amid growing demand for diesel oil in China while domestic sales are on the decline.

Among other major Japanese oil companies, Nippon Oil Corp. has already won an order to refine gasoline and diesel oil on behalf of China United Petroleum, a group company of China National Petroleum Corp.
